Hepatic failure patient's serum before and after plasmapheresis induces the differentiation of umbilical cord mesenchymal stem cells into hepatic cells

Abstract
BACKGROUND: Umbilical cord mesenchymal stem cells (UC-MSCs) have made certain curative effect on hepatic failure, but little is reported on the effect of hepatic failure patient's serum microenvironment on UC-MSCs differentiation ability. OBJECTIVE: To investigate the effect of hepatic failure patient's serum on the differentiation of umbilical cord mesenchymal stem cells into hepatic cells. METHODS: UC-MSCs were isolated by tissue adherent method and the cell morphology and phenotype identified by microscope and flow cytometry. Alpha-MEM media with serum before/after plasmapheresis were used to culture the hirdgeneration of UC-MSCs, and regular fetal bovine serum culture medium acted as control group. Inverted microscope was used to observe the cell morphology in three groups. Immunohistochemical method was used to measure expression level of alpha fetoprotein, albumin and cytokeratin 18. RESULTS AND CONCLUSION: A great amount of high-purity UC-MSCs could be obtained using tissue adherent method, which highly expressed CD44, CD73, CD90, CD10, but did not express CD45. Hepatic failure patient's serum could change the morphology of UC-MSCs and induce UC-MSCs to express alpha fetoprotein, albumin and cytokeratin 18. The positive expression of alpha fetoprotein, albumin and cytokeratin 18 was significantly increased after plasmapheresis (P < 0.05). To conclude, hepatic failure patient's serum after plasmapheresis exert more benefits to induce UC-MSCs to differentiate into hepatic cells than that before plasmapheresis.关键词
